2021-07-28 23:14:32 +0000 UTCI made a solo trip from Chicago to Idaho many years ago. After a long day of driving I'd be parched. I would always check the vehicles in the parking lot. A lot full of shitty beaters, not my spot. When I found a place, I'd do a quick scan of what they were drinking and order the same. I'd be cordial, but not friendly and never have more than 2 beers.
